Biography: Steven Soderbergh is an influential director, screenwriter, cinematographer and editor.

Soderbergh came to fame as the youngest person to ever win the Palme D'Or at 26 with his indie film "Sex Lies and Videotape" (1989).

He has gone on direct such Hollywood films as "Erin Brockovich" (2000), "Traffic" (2000) for which he won an Oscar for Best Director and "Magic Mike" (2012).

Soderbergh has also directed the Ocean's trilogy starring George Clooney, a remake of the Rat Pack film "Oceans 11" (1960).
